Event Details
A woman near the fireside had her youngest infant in her lap and a second child playing nearby; the second child fell into a kettle of boiling water. In haste, she threw the infant on the bed, rescued the second child but found it lifeless, sent the eldest boy to fetch the father from the barn, where the boy ran among horses that kicked out his brains; meanwhile, she found the infant dead with its neck across the bedstead headboard.
